Resurfaced Steve Harvey Interview Goes Viral Where He Claims Men And Women Can't Be Friends

Whether or not men and women can just be friends with no ulterior motives has been a hotly debated topic for a long, long time, and will often leave people forced to agree to disagree.

Television personality Steve Harvey discussed the issue in an interview clip that has since gone viral after resurfacing over ten years later.

A resurfaced interview clip from 2010 has gone viral for the comments Steve Harvey made about men and women being friends.

"I don't have female friends," Steve tells the interviewer. "I don't. I'm incapable of that," he went on. "Because, you know, come on... Well, because I have a wife, and-- okay, let's get rid of this myth right here."

"You're an attractive woman," he says.

"There's some guy somewhere saying, 'yeah, we're friends,' that's not true," Steve went on. "He's your friend only because you have made it absolutely clear that nothing else is happening except this friendship we have."

"We remain your friends in hopes that one day, there'll be a crack in the door, a chink in the armor," Steve said.

"Trust and believe that the guy that you think is just your buddy... he will slide in that crack the moment he gets the opportunity. Because we're guys! 99.9% of us think that way."

Steve's comments immediately started catching heat on social media.

Many fans pointed out that this implies men don't really see women as people, just as potential relationships.

"Steve Harvey is a misogynist and sexist so let’s start there. He is “incapable” of being friends with woman because he doesn’t see their value as people beyond what he can get for them sexually. That’s a flaw on his part. If he viewed women as people, this wouldn’t be a problem," tweeted one user.

Others defended his viewpoint.
